The Illinois Resolution Regarding Corporate Name Change — Corporate Resolutions is a legal document used by corporations registered in the state of Illinois to officially change their corporate name. This resolution outlines the process and requirements necessary for the name change to be approved and recognized by the state authorities. The resolution begins by identifying the corporation seeking the name change and its current legal name. It includes a brief explanation of the reasons behind the desired name change, which may include rebranding, mergers, acquisitions, or simply updating their image or aligning with a new business direction. The resolution then outlines the steps that need to be taken to effectuate the name change. This may include notifying the corporation's board of directors of the name change proposal, conducting a vote to approve the resolution, and obtaining the necessary signatures from the board members or other relevant parties. Additionally, the resolution typically includes provisions requiring the corporation to comply with any legal or regulatory requirements related to the name change. This may involve submitting the required documents and fees to the Illinois Secretary of State's office or any other designated regulatory authority. It is important for the resolution to provide a clear and unambiguous statement of the corporation's new name. This ensures that there is no confusion regarding the corporation's identity while conducting business or interacting with other entities. Once the resolution has been approved and signed by all necessary parties, it becomes an enforceable legal document. The corporation is then responsible for taking all the necessary steps to update its official records, including amending the Articles of Incorporation, updating corporate bylaws, and informing shareholders, clients, suppliers, and other relevant stakeholders of the name change. Types of Illinois Resolution Regarding Corporate Name Change — Corporate Resolutions: 1. General Corporate Name Change Resolution: This type of resolution is used by corporations in Illinois that wish to change their name for various reasons mentioned above. 2. Merger or Acquisition Name Change Resolution: In cases where a corporation is involved in a merger or acquisition, a specific name change resolution may be required to reflect the new entity resulting from the transaction. 3. Rebranding Name Change Resolution: When a corporation aims to reposition itself in the market or change its business image, a rebranding name change resolution is utilized to facilitate the process. In conclusion, the Illinois Resolution Regarding Corporate Name Change — Corporate Resolutions provides a structured and legally valid process for corporations in Illinois to change their names. It ensures compliance with state laws and regulations while safeguarding the corporation's identity during the transition.

Board resolutions should be written on the organization's letterhead. The wording simply describes the action that the board agreed to take. It also shows the date of the action and it names the parties to the resolution.

A corporate resolution form is used by a board of directors. Its purpose is to provide written documentation that a business is authorized to take specific action. This form is most often used by limited liability companies, s-corps, c-corps, and limited liability partnerships.

Types of Corporate Resolutions A resolution might outline the officers that are authorized to act (trade, assign, transfer or hedge securities and other assets) on behalf of the corporation. The resolution would outline who is authorized to open a bank account, withdraw money, and write checks.

Elements of a Certified Board ResolutionExplanation of the action being taken by the board of directors and the reason for doing so. Name of the secretary. Legal name of the corporation and state of incorporation. Names of the board of directors voting for approval of the resolution.

A resolution can be made by a corporation's board of directors, shareholders on behalf of a corporation, a non-profit board of directors, or a government entity.

A corporate resolution is a document that formally records the important binding decisions into which a company enters. These decisions are made by such stakeholders as the corporation's managers, directors, officers or owners.
